DECATUR'S CRUISE TO ALGIERS

DECATUR'S CRUISE TO ALGIERS. On 2 March 1815, the United States declared war on Algiers for its hostility during the War of 1812. On 20 May, Capt. Stephen Decatur sailed with three frigates, three brigs, two schooners, and a sloop the Guerri è re being his flagship. Off Cape Gata, Spain, on 17 June, he captured the Algerian frigate Mashuda and killed its commander, Reis Hammida.
